Dr. Rajendra Prasad was elected the first President of India in 1950 by an electoral college consisting of members of the Constituent Assembly (who also served as the provisional parliament). This election occurred under the transitional provisions of the Constitution before the first general elections of 1951-52 established the regular electoral college.
